More about the book

Set in New England, this novel explores the sexual awakening of Charity Royall, a young woman raised by her guardian, Lawyer Royall, after being abandoned by her parents. Yearning for a more vibrant life, she becomes involved with Lucius Harney, an architect from the city, igniting a controversial affair that challenges societal norms. The story delves into themes of freedom versus repression and the societal expectations placed on women in early 20th-century America, making it a timeless commentary on personal and social struggles.
